What is ESBE 3G Shader for MCPE?
ESBE 3G is a performance-friendly shader developed specifically for Minecraft PE that dramatically improves your game’s visual quality. Unlike many other MCPE shader packs that cause lag or crashes, ESBE 3G is optimized for mobile devices while still offering:
- Beautiful realistic water reflections and waves
- Enhanced sunlight and moonlight effects
- Improved shadows and lighting
- Subtle but effective volumetric fog
- Realistic cloud formations

Installing ESBE 3G Shader on MCPE 1.21.62
Once you’ve downloaded the ESBE 3G Shader pack, follow these installation steps:
Direct Installation Method
- Locate the downloaded .mcpack file on your device
- Tap the file to open it (Minecraft PE should launch automatically)
- Wait for the “Import Started” message
- Once you see “Import Successful,” the shader has been added to your game
Activating ESBE 3G Shader
After importing the shader, you need to activate it in your game:
- Open Minecraft PE 1.21.62
- Tap “Settings” then “Global Resources”
- Find ESBE 3G Shader under “My Packs”
- Tap the shader pack to activate it
- Confirm by tapping “Apply” at the bottom of the screen

Device-Specific Recommendations
Different devices handle shaders differently:
- Newer phones/tablets: Can run ESBE 3G at maximum settings
- Mid-range devices: May need reduced render distance
- Older devices: Consider using ESBE 2G instead, which is even lighter

Comparing ESBE 3G With Other MCPE Shaders
ESBE 3G is one of several popular shaders for MCPE 1.21.62. Here’s how it compares:
- ESBE 3G vs. SEUS PE: ESBE is lighter and runs better on most devices
- ESBE 3G vs. Continuum Shader: ESBE offers better performance with slightly less visual fidelity
- ESBE 3G vs. ESBE 2G: 3G has more features but requires slightly better hardware
